Whip City Travelers

The Whip City Travelers organize trips for area citizens at the Westfield Council On Aging / Senior Center. Some of these trips include monthly casino trips to Mohegan and Foxwoods, Atlantic City, and multiple day or one day trips that include luncheons or dinner.

Additional Information

  • All trips are booked on a first come, first serve basis and are open to the general public. Participants need not be seniors (over 60) to go on any of the trips
  • The group requests that people with physical challenges have a companion who is not physically challenged accompany them on trips.
  • Single day trips must be paid in full at time of sign-up. Seats for the casino day trips will be assigned beginning on the posted sign-up day and only when payment is received. Those who call for tickets will be put on a waiting list.
  • Deposits vary depending upon the tour being offered. Deposit information is available either on the trip flyer or by contacting the Whip City Travelers.
  • Reservations: All trips must be paid one full month in advance so payment can be made to the bus company.
  • All trip prices include gratuities to the bus driver and tour guides.

  • Times for trip sign-ups are on the following days and times only:
    • Mondays from 9 a.m. - 12 Noon
    • Fridays from 9 a.m. - 12 Noon
Trip sign-up dates will be strictly adhered to. Checks should be made payable to "Whip City Travelers". Credit cards and post-dated checks are not accepted.
